Welcome to MemCard.art, a BIG gallery of tiny art that lives inside PlayStation memory cards. Right now there are
2,107 individual games on the site and I'm adding new ones as often as I can. You can browse the latest additions right here or use the menus to find exactly what you want to see.
If you're wondering what these little pixelart GIFs even are, take a look at this post for an explainer on memory cards, icons, and gaming history!
